Monticello, Denver, CO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Monticello?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Monticello 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,537 | $985 | $2,718 |
| Monticello 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,705 | $1,210 | $2,924 |
| Monticello 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,600 | $1,460 | $3,637 |
| Monticello 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,040 | $2,040 | $2,040 |
